State five conditions by which the point of equilibrium of the following reversible reaction can be shifted towards left.
`N_2+3H_2iff2NH_3+Qcal.`

`N_2+3H_2iff2NH_3+Qcal`.
The five condition by which the point of equilibrium of the above reversible reaction is shifted towards left are as follows
(a) Decreasing the concentration of nitrogen.
(b) Decreasing the concentration of hydrogen.
(c) Increasing the concentration of ammonia.
(d) Increasing the temperature.
(e) Decreasing the pressure.
